@CHARSET "UTF-8";



body {
	font-family: 'Open Sans', 'trebuchet ms', sans-serif;
	color: black;
	font-size: 1.375em;
	margin: 0px;
	padding: 0px;
	line-height: 1.3;
	font-weight: 400;
	-webkit-font-smoothing: antialiased;
	 font-smoothing: antialiased;

	 text-align: center;
	 vertical-align: middle;
}

.table_main {
	height: 100%;
	width: 100%;
}

.table_main, .table_main td {
	vertical-align: middle;
}
.div_page {
	background: white;
	max-width: 800px;
	
	margin: 50%;
	margin: 0px auto;
	margin-top: 0px;
	padding: 50px 50px 100px 100px;
	vertical-align: middle;
	text-align: left;
	
	box-sizing: border-box;
	-moz-box-sizing: border-box;
}




p {
	margin: 0px 0px 20px 0px;
}

h1 {
	font-size: 2em;
	font-weight: 600;
	padding: 0px;
	margin: 0px 0px 20px 0px;
}



a, a:visited {
	color: #1FB6F2;

}

a:hover {
	opacity: 0.8;
}


.div_mediakit {
	vertical-align: middle;
	padding-right: 30px;
}

b {
	font-weight: 600;
}


html, body {
    height: 100%;
}

@media screen and (max-width: 989px) { 
	body {
		font-size: 1em;
	}
	.div_page {
		padding: 20px 15px 20px 15px;
	}
}